Eastern Maar Aboriginal Corporation RNTBC

Eastern Maar Aboriginal Corporation RNTBC is an Indigenous corporation registered with ORIC and the ACNC. As a Registered Native Title Body Corporate, it holds and manages native title rights and interests for the Eastern Maar people in Victoria, supporting their self-determination and cultural heritage.
